Finished my pedal board!!!

Sign in to disble this ad
So, here it is...

Path is:

Tuner, mammoth, bass drive, pog, Qballs, small stone, BDDI

Just got the enigma this morning to replace a broken bassballs and although i really like it, it seams like a pretty wild pedal and i guess its going to take some time getting used to!
It gets out of control really fast and the distortion gets really loud in some settings... ( i did lower the volume of it inside but it still gets realllllly loud on some settings!)

I think thats it, no more room, and iv got a got pedal for every effect i need, im done!
